Hi team,

I'm handing over the Pebblekit mobile crash-report pipeline before my rotation ends. Symbolication runs on the crashmill workers; dSYM uploads must land before each release or reports arrive unsymbolicated. The ingest queue backs up if retention pruning is skipped — check it weekly. Runbooks are in the pipeline wiki, including the redrive procedure for stuck batches. Signed symbol bundles are verified at ingest, so future maintainers will need the pipeline's signing key, recorded below.

rollout seal: bky4_x7Gc

**Dependency pinning for Larkspire plugins**

All third-party plugins must pin direct dependencies to exact versions; ranges and wildcards are rejected at submission. Transitive dependencies are resolved by our lockfile generator, so do not vendor them yourself. Security patches trigger an automated re-pin proposal, which you have ten days to accept. The complete policy, exemption process, and tooling guide are published internally here.

wiki page, tahaf-tajog: https://jira.ordindyn.corp/pipeline

Q: What are the building hours over the holiday period?

A: From 24 December to 2 January, Calder Point operates on reduced hours. The main reception closes at 18:00, and the front doors lock automatically after that. Night-shift staff should enter via the east stairwell door, which remains active around the clock during the holiday window. Security patrols continue as normal, so sign the night register on arrival. To release the east stairwell door, use the code below.

turnstile pass: bdg-FVNQRS-72965873

## Configuration

Proctorline's queue worker reads everything from .env. Set QUEUE_REGION to the shard you were assigned (ask in the team channel), MAX_SESSIONS to 40 for local runs, and HEARTBEAT_MS to 5000. Do not raise MAX_SESSIONS locally; the mock invigilator service will fall over. Keep .env out of commits. After the HEARTBEAT_MS line, add the session-token secret on the following line.

sealed setting: ARCHIVE_KEY3=8d0